On page 59 of the Ork Codex Mad Dok Grotsnik. In his wargear he has Dok's Tools
goto p38 for Painboy under wargear - "Dok's Tools: A Painboy is an expert at repairing the sturdy Ork physique using a variety of mean-looking tools. He confers the Feel No Pain ability to his unit."
Mad Dok might be one scalpel short, but he still confers FNP to the unit he is attached. FNP is a 5+ extra roll after save.
